Output e076823ba81c9653e3cf264baee34c57440afa66027a743cee4c4ed2f8240677:37

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 d5c71e63eecda53a8f068ef04cc0a1102fa45822
address
tb1q6hr3uclwekjn4rcx3mcyes9pzqh6gkpzl06kdx
transaction
e076823ba81c9653e3cf264baee34c57440afa66027a743cee4c4ed2f8240677
confirmations
12953
spent
true